I used only the Canon Powershot s400 (Elph) for the entire 4 weeks of a trip to Turkey -- seehttp://www.pbase.com/andrys/turkey . One caveat is that my monitor was getting too dark so I processed the pictures too bright, but it should give an idea of what you can get if there is a used one available. It's a camera that many still seek out because the lens is said to be better, overall, than subsequent models of that size. The later s410 is a bit better, using the same lens but its red-light focus-aid feature having better quality control. I used the latter for pictures in Italy after my s400 was stolen.
